Fees (Indicative)

Tuition fees for this course are indicative at A$18,000, with non-tuition fees of A$950, bringing the estimated total to A$18,950. Please note that these figures are sourced from the CRICOS register and are subject to change. Additional costs not included are Overseas Student Health Cover (OSHC), living expenses, and the visa application charge. For the most current fees, visit the provider's website at http://enhance.edu.au. ALBURY COLLEGE PTY LTD sets its own fees, so always confirm directly before applying. Work Component

This course does not include a mandatory work component. However, student visa holders are permitted to work up to 48 hours per fortnight during term and unlimited hours during scheduled breaks, subject to visa conditions. This allows students to gain practical experience in the hospitality industry while studying. Many students find part-time work in restaurants, hotels, or cafes to supplement their income and build professional networks. Always check the current work rights on the Department of Home Affairs website, as conditions may change. Student Visa Information

International students need a Student Visa (Subclass 500) to study this course. Key requirements include: Confirmation of Enrolment (CoE), evidence of English proficiency (IELTS 5.5-6.0), Overseas Student Health Cover (OSHC), and sufficient funds for tuition, living costs, and travel. The Genuine Temporary Entrant (GTE) criterion assesses your intention to stay temporarily in Australia. Living costs vary by location: in Parramatta, weekly rent is around $250-$400, groceries $70-$120, and transport $30-$50. For South Brisbane and Southport, costs may be slightly lower. Always check the Department of Home Affairs website or consult a registered migration agent for the most up-to-date information. Note that HeadStart Academy does not provide immigration advice.
